Entry basics
Passport validity: at least 6 months beyond your date of entry into Thailand.
Proof of funds (spot-check): immigration may ask for cash equivalent to ฿20,000 per person on arrival. Enforcement is inconsistent but non-zero, especially for solo travellers on one-way tickets.
Common issues for India passport holders
- India got 60-day visa-exempt in 2024 — massive uptick in Pattaya visitors
- OCI cardholders may still need visa — check status
- Indian community in Pattaya centred on Central Rd; Indian restaurants widespread
